Rosemead in Los Angeles County, California — The American West (Pacific Coastal)
 

Lester Burdick

(1879–1946)

— Savannah Memorial Park —

 
 
Lester Burdick Marker image. Click for full size.
Photographed By J. J. Prats, December 1, 2018
1. Lester Burdick Marker
Inscription. Moved to El Monte in 1887. Active in farming, engineering and plumbing. Appointed Deputy Constable, El Monte (1906); El Monte Township Constable (1907–1935); when El Monte was incorporated in 1912, he became the first Chief of Police (1912–1937). He continued his work in plumbing, helping to set engines and installing pumps for irrigation purposes. He also donated a great deal of time installing meters for the new city water system in 1914, and installing the new sewer system in 1923. A citizen of sterling character and a most conscientious public official.
